Transaction 162d5566bd5d100db831e1fc52fd952eb3d254fa28a1c698020820621e9f2ef8
1 Input
1 Output
-
162d5566bd5d100db831e1fc52fd952eb3d254fa28a1c698020820621e9f2ef8:0
- value
- 612613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7180eeb93f19cc0994472934da354e6cfb477892 OP_EQUAL
- address
- 3C3AjcG18D6iUCeXPHResoyrcisXPdyWDt